SB 3024 Mississippi Senate · 2025 Regular Session

Appropriation; Counselors, Board of Examiners for Licensed Professional.

SB 3024 appropriates $378,711 in state funds to cover the Mississippi State Board of Examiners for Licensed Professional Counselors' expenses for fiscal year 2026 (July 1, 2025-June 30, 2026). The bill specifically allocates $100,000 toward updating the board's Licensing Management System. It requires the board to maintain detailed financial records comparable to previous years and mandates that funds be used in compliance with state budget laws and procurement preferences for Mississippi Industries for the Blind. This is a funding measure, not a policy change, directly affecting the board's operations and licensing processes for professional counselors.

What changed between versions

As Introduced Current version · 5 edits
MODERATE
This bill remains substantively unchanged in its core purpose of appropriating $378,711.00 for the Mississippi State Board of Examiners for Licensed Professional Counselors for fiscal year 2026. The primary changes are formatting and presentation updates reflecting the bill's progression from introduction to passage, including updated page headers and some minor text formatting adjustments. No substantive policy, funding, or eligibility changes were made.
